Each spring, folks across Japan observe "hanami," a treasured tradition of viewing nature"s breathtaking display of cherry blossoms. Japanese cherry trees, known as "sakura," reach full bloom in March in the south of the country. Our homepage picture shows cherry blossoms cascading over the moats which surround the Imperial Palace in Tokyo.
